首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
请补充函数fun,其功能是:计算并输出给定10个数的方差: 例如,给定的10个数为15.0,19.0,16.0,15.0,18.0,12.0, 15.0,11.0,10.0,16.0,输出为s=2.758623。 注意:部分源程序给出如
请补充函数fun,其功能是:计算并输出给定10个数的方差: 例如,给定的10个数为15.0,19.0,16.0,15.0,18.0,12.0, 15.0,11.0,10.0,16.0,输出为s=2.758623。 注意:部分源程序给出如
admin
2010-05-05
20
问题
请补充函数fun,其功能是:计算并输出给定10个数的方差:
例如,给定的10个数为15.0,19.0,16.0,15.0,18.0,12.0, 15.0,11.0,10.0,16.0,输出为s=2.758623。
注意:部分源程序给出如下。
请勿改动主函数main和其他函数中的任何内容,仅在函数fun()的横线上填入所编写的若干表达式或语句。
试题程序:
#include<stdio.h>
#include<math. h>
double fun (double x[10])
{
int i;
double avg=0.0;
double sum=0.0;
double abs=0.0;
double sd;
for (i=0; i<10; i++)
【 】;
avg=sum/10;
for(i=0;i<10;i++)
【 】;
sd=【 】;
return sd;
}
main()
{
double s,x[10]={15.0,19.0,16.0,15.0,
18.0,12.0,15.0,11.0,10.0,16.0};
int i;
printf("\nThe original data is :\n");
for(i=0;i<10;i++)
printf("%6.1f",x
);
printf("\n\n");
s=fun(x);
printf("s=%f\n\n",s);
}
选项
答案
sum+=x[i] abs+=(x[i]-avg)*(x[i]-avg) sqrt(abs/10)
解析
第一空:根据求方差的公式可知,首先要求出10个数的平均值,此处是利用for循环对10个数求累加和。第二空:使用for循环求出每个数与平均值之差的平方和。第三空:通过开方,求出10个数的方差,此处需要注意对库函数sqrt()的调用。
转载请注明原文地址:https://kaotiyun.com/show/KHID777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列关于云计算的说法错误的是()。
近年来,随着我国经济从卖方市场转向买方市场,许多企业根据市场需求变化,积极开发和研制新产品,取得了良好的经济效益。但也有一些企业因商品滞销而减产甚至停产。这说明()。
甲挑唆乙(甲、乙均已成年)去打正在熟睡的狗,狗被激怒后追乙,恰巧丙经过,乙便躲在丙的身后,狗将丙咬伤。根据《侵权责任法》的有关规定,下列表述错误的是()。
根据我国《宪法》规定,决定战争与和平问题的职权由()。
根据我国有关法律的规定,下列哪一行为是不合法的?()
法院审理一起受贿案时,被告人甲称因侦查人员刑讯不得已承认犯罪事实,并讲述受到刑讯的具体时间。检察机关为证明侦查讯问程序合法,当庭播放了有关讯问的录音录像,并提交了书面说明。关于该录音录像的证据种类,下列哪一选项是正确的?()
根据国务院办公厅部分节假日安排的通知,某年8月份有22个工作日,那么当年的8月1日可能是:
小李的弟弟比小李小2岁,小王的哥哥比小王大2岁、比小李大5岁。1994年,小李的弟弟和小王的年龄之和为15。问2014年小李与小王的年龄分别为多少岁?
如下图所示,正方形ABCD的边长是14厘米,其中,BE=CE=7厘米。如果点P以每秒2厘米的速度沿着边线CD从点C出发到点D,那么三角形AEP的面积将以每秒()平方厘米的速度增加。
随机试题
固一世之雄也,而今安在哉固:
A.卵黄囊B.胆囊C.淋巴管D.肝脾E.骨髓胚胎第5周时主要造血器官是
甲公司将一工程发包给乙建筑公司,经甲公司同意,乙公司将部分非主体工程分包给丙建筑公司,丙公司又将其中一部分分包给丁建筑公司。后丁公司因工作失误致使工程不合格,甲公司欲索赔。对此,下列哪些说法是正确的?(2010—卷三—59,多)
商检合格的出口商品,发货人应当在检验证书或放行单全发之日起60天内报运出口,鲜活类出口商品应在规定期限内报运出口,逾期必须重新报验。( )
退休后的收入来源渠道包括()。
被称为“驱梨园领袖,总编修师首,捻杂剧班头”的是()。
正午太阳高度周年变化的根本原因是:
设在SQLServer2008某数据库中,已建立了四个文件组:fg1、fg2、fg3和fg4,以及一个分区函数RangePF1。RangePF1的定义代码如下:CREATEPARTITIONFUNCTIONRangePF1(int)
欲构造ArrayList类的一个实例,此类继承厂List接口,下列哪个方法是正确的?()
Dr.SheelerwassurprisedatMr.Nelson’scallbecause______.
最新回复
(
0
)